
This article presents the basic rules for teaching elements of combinatorics in elementary mathematics classes and methods for explaining combinatorics problems in a form suitable for elementary school students. The article reveals the importance of developing students' mathematical literacy, explaining combinatorics problems, and analyzing them through critical thinking. In particular, the article discusses the theoretical foundations of combinatorics and the relevance of teaching it in elementary school. In particular, it provides information about the development of combinatorics and emphasizes the relevance of teaching it starting from elementary school. The importance of developing students' critical thinking, independent thinking, and problem-solving skills through combinatorics problems is emphasized. The article provides practical examples of the rules of addition and multiplication, which are the basis of combinatorics, and explains how to solve combinatorics problems using such rules and laws. It is also noted that combinatorics is interconnected with algebra, geometry, and probability theory and helps to master these disciplines in more depth starting from the primary grades. The article concludes that teaching the elements of combinatorics in the primary grades serves to develop students' logical thinking and creates a basic foundation for further strengthening of mathematical knowledge. The article also describes the main methods used in teaching the elements of combinatorics.
